Overview of Garage Rock musician Meatbodies
The American garage rock group Meatbodies hails from Los Angeles. Heavy rock riffs, trippy melodies, and hard-hitting drum beats are all mixed together in their music. Their music is characterized by distorted guitar riffs, vocals with a lot of reverb, and a rhythm section that keeps everything moving.
The band draws inspiration from groups like The Stooges, MC5, and The Sonics, and their music is largely influenced by the garage rock culture of the 1960s and 1970s. They have a devoted fan base all around the world thanks to their music's energetic performances and memorable hooks.

What are the most popular songs for Garage Rock musician Meatbodies?
The American band Meatbodies is well-known for their garage rock songs and hails from Los Angeles. The songs "Fools Fold Their Hands (Grievous Evils Under the Sun)," "Disorder," "Mountain," "Wahoo," "Plank," "Tremmors," "Disciples," "Creature Feature," "Alice," and "Him" are among their most well-known.
One of their most well-known songs, "Disorder," opens with an infectious guitar melody and a pulsing beat that gets you moving. The song has a gritty, unpolished tone that perfectly captures the spirit of garage rock. Another well-liked song, "Wahoo," has a quick tempo and powerful guitar riffs that produce a vibrant and upbeat mood.
Another well-liked song with a slower speed and a more melodic feel is "Mountain." The song demonstrates the group's ability to produce a variety of rock music styles. With distorted guitars and hazy vocals, the song "Fools Fold Their Hands (Grievous Evils Under the Sun)" has a psychedelic vibe.

What are the latest songs and music albums for Garage Rock musician Meatbodies?
The Los Angeles-based rock and garage rock group Meatbodies published their most recent album, "333," in 2021. It features their distinctive sound and wide-ranging musical influences. The eleven songs on the album range in style from the powerful "The Hero" to the more melodic "Guns." The album is filled with Meatbodies' distinctive distorted guitar riffs and pounding drumming, making it the ideal background music for headbanging and moshing.
Meatbodies have released a number of songs this year in addition to their most recent album, including "Cancer," "The Hero," and "Reach for the Sunn." Which are the most important music performances and festival appearances for Garage Rock musician Meatbodies?
The Los Angeles rock and garage rock band Meatbodies has gained a lot of recognition for their energetic performances and festival appearances. Numerous prestigious events, including Cabaret Vert, Binic Folks Blues Festival, LEVITATION Austin, Treefort Music Fest, and Pop Montreal, have featured them.
